Gold prices on May 13 morning recovered after falling 1.57% on May 12, Report informs.
The price of June gold futures on the Comex New York Stock Exchange rose by $0.45, or 0.02%, to $1,825.76 per troy ounce. July silver futures rose 0.21% to $20.816 an ounce.
The gold market on May 13 morning saw growth after a price decrease of 1.57% a day earlier. Such dynamics was facilitated by a sharp rise in the dollar index to 104.93 points.
